i driving BT 20v. not sure about urs.facing same problem last time. turned on can heard aircond fan running. after a while, led started blinking, fan stopped. found out fuse burned. the fuse is located just right under the glove box at the passenger side.(better check this one before you start changing other things)

after changed, no more blinking. thought yeah, finally can go out toasting :beer:. but found out how come fan totally not spinning now. no choice lo, need to look for aircond sifu. lastly checked and found out sensor kong(if you open up, it has 4 kaki). i'm not really sure this thing call sensor or what. could be some members here called it "aircond ecu". i will snap pic tomorrow so you know which one i mentioned. make sure you replace it with DENSO and NO NO NO other imitations. before that, i kena already because i replaced it with imitations since the taukeh told me denso out of stocks. FYI, once this sensor has been taken out, you need to pump in new gas. yes! yes! yes! aircond is working now.. but u know what has happened next? the fan keep on spinning non stop. ask the taukeh why like that, he also not sure and told me wiring issue. i told him cannot be what. checked many times here and there but still couldnt rectify the problem :banghead:

no choice lo. need to go back already because got other things to do. next day, dont want go back there already. i just brought my car to denso dealer and told the expert what i did and replaced. straight away he told me, if those sensor has 4 kaki means it has extra functions. usually other car sensor has 3 kaki. this sensor has extra function to control the aircond fan 2-way speed, slow and fast. no choice but need to replace again and pump in new gas which cost me more(hard earn money ma, of cos boh syok lo). but luckily ori denso sensor cost me 60 bucks. after that, all fixed.....at nite sleeping also can smile :proud:.

yes, if you found out the fuse keep on burn after it has been replaced, it might be your compressor causing it because running overload. hope it helps.

A/C lights blinking...
So conclusion (through you others expediences ) :

- Faulty Compressor
- A/C gas running low
- snap belt (still can consider compressor faulty or not running as it didn't turn it)
- faulty A/C ECU box

any other that we missed ?
 
some more aircond relay also can make this a/c light blinking.
